Thermoelectric cooling - Wikipedia
A Peltier cooler, heater, or thermoelectric heat pump is a solid-state active heat pump which transfers heat from one side of the device to the other, with consumption of electrical energy, depending on the direction of the current.

Thermoelectric Cooling Devices (Peltier) | How it works, Application ...
Thermoelectric cooling devices, commonly referred to as Peltier devices, are a significant innovation in the field of heat management and cooling technology. Named after the French physicist Jean Charles Athanase Peltier, who discovered the Peltier effect, these devices operate on an entirely different principle than conventional cooling systems.
